Sandra
Snow is associate professor of music education and choral conducting at
the Michigan State University College of Music.
Prior to joining the MSU faculty, she served on the faculties of the
University of Michigan and Northern Illinois University, and as music
director of the Glen Ellyn Children's Chorus. She is a nationally known
choral clinician, conductor, and music educator. Snow also edits several
Boosey & Hawkes choral publication series, including "In High Voice,"
and recently co-authored a chapter in the revised edition of the
textbook, "Dimensions of Musical Learning and Teaching." She is
frequently engaged as principal conductor and keynoter for state and
national music educator association conferences and festivals, including
American Choral Director Association National Conferences.
